The Benefits of an Ethanol Fireplace
Ethanol fireplaces can be a fantastic alternative to wood or gas fires because they don't need the use of a chimney or a flue. They don't create smoke or ash, or create any mess and can easily be moved from one location to another.
Only use bio-ethanol on burners specifically designed to burn the fuel. Other gels and liquid fuels can void the warranty on your burner.
Cost
The cost of a bioethanol fire place varies according to the model and type you pick. There are models that range from a few hundred dollars to a few thousand, however, they are generally less expensive than wood or gas fireplace. Certain models are freestanding, and others are attached to a fireplace, or recessed into the wall. Ethanol fires are also more eco sustainable than wood-burning ones.
Bio ethanol fires are very popular due to their natural, beautiful flame without any smoke or soot. They can be used in almost any room, and they are easy to maintain. You should only make use of bio-ethanol fuels that have been specifically designed for fireplaces like these. Other types of fuel could damage the burner, thereby increasing the risk of fire. It is also recommended to avoid storing flammable substances near the bioethanol flame.
They are great for heating rooms, but should not be your main source of warmth. They are more efficient than wood-burning fire places and can generate a lot of heat, Stone fireplaces around 2kW on average. This will not be enough to heat a whole home, but it will certainly warm smaller rooms.

Environmental impact
An ethanol fireplace can be an eco-friendly alternative to traditional wood-burning fireplaces. Bioethanol fuel is made by utilizing waste plant materials like corn, straw and maize. The liquid biofuel then undergoes further distillation to let it burn efficiently and cleanly. This type of fuel is an energy source that is renewable and doesn't emit harmful odours or emissions. In addition, it is free of soot and smoke which makes it a safer choice for your home over other kinds of fires.
They can be positioned in any room in your home since they don't require chimneys or venting systems. They are easy to use and most models come with at least one remote control. A lot of them have an inbuilt cooling system to prevent the fuel from overheating. They can be used as a primary heating source or ethanol fires an additional heating source. They are also a good choice for people who live in apartments or condos.
Bioethanol fireplaces produce very minimal smells. They are therefore an ideal option for homes with people who suffer from allergies or asthma. In fact, this kind of fireplace can be installed in a nursery for babies or a child's bedroom. It is important to remember, however, that these fireplaces must be kept at a safe distance from objects that ignite, like curtains and furniture.

Safety
A bioethanol fireplace is an alternative to open flame. They are simple to operate, generate less smoke and burn more efficiently than other alternatives. As with all fireplaces, and other devices that produce fire they could be dangerous if they are used incorrectly. Fireplaces that are constructed with wood require special care and attention, so it's important to read the directions carefully and follow them closely.
When using a bio-ethanol fireplace ensure that it is in a well-ventilated room and away from other combustible materials. Also keep pets and children away from it. Do not move it while the fire is still burning. This can cause an explosion.
Bio ethanol fireplaces aren't as hazardous as gas or wood fireplaces, however there are certain safety guidelines that must be adhered to in order to ensure safe operation. These include keeping flammable items at least 1500mm away from the flame and not touching it while the flame is burning. Also, it's important to never refill a fire with unapproved fuel.
The burning process of bio-ethanol fire places is secure, particularly when you follow the guidelines. Fuel is pumped through a vapour-accelerator, which evaporates before being ignited with filament. This method of combustion ensures that the fuel is fully combusted, which eliminates smell and harmful substances like dioxins and furans.

Installation
A bioethanol fireplace can add warmth and ambiance to a room. They come in various designs and can be set up using a variety of methods. They can be built-in, wall-mounted or freestanding. They can also be see-through. However, it is recommended to read the installation instructions of a particular fireplace before installing it. This will help you avoid any issues during installation and ensure your fireplace is safe to use.
The procedure of installing bioethanol fireplaces is simple. It involves putting in the burner and then building a frame to be inserted into the wall. The frame should be constructed of an inert material that is not flammable. This will prevent the burner from burning the wall. It also helps prevent the flame from spreading to other parts of the room. The frame should be fixed to the wall using appropriate screws and dowels.
